Linoleum Floor Installation in Boulder, CO

Linoleum floor installation involves the process of laying durable, versatile flooring made from natural materials such as linseed oil, cork dust, wood flour, and limestone. This service is commonly requested for residential projects including kitchens, bathrooms, basements, and laundry rooms, where a resilient and easy-to-maintain surface is desired. Linoleum Floor Installation Questions

What rooms are suitable for linoleum flooring? Linoleum is versatile and can be installed in k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and other high-traffic areas.

How durable is linoleum flooring? Linoleum offers good resilience against wear and is resistant to moisture, making it suitable for busy and humid spaces.

What preparation is needed before installing linoleum? The subfloor should be clean, level, and dry to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ish.

Can linoleum be installed over existing flooring? Yes, linoleum can often be installed over existing surfaces if they are in good condition and properly prepared.
